Modern downtown San Diego was established in the late 1800s when it was decided to relocate the city from alongside the river to the harbor front. Downtown San Diego is bordered on the West and South by the harbor, and on the North and East by the curve of Highway '5'.

Today Downtown San Diego can offer a great variety of attractions, events, activities, entertainment, dining and shopping. It has also become a desireable place to live, with a number of new homes being built since the late 1990s. These new residences are in the neighborhoods of downtown, from the new 'East Village', to the older 'Cortez Hill' and Little Italy.
